To commemorate the great contributions of ancestors of various ethnic groups on the road to nation-building, the Singapore Federation of Chinese Clan Associations (SFCCA) held the “Four Races’ Struggle to Build the Nation” New Immigrants and Singapore Society Series Seminar at the SFCCA multi-purpose hall on 13th December 2015 (Sunday) at 2pm.

Speakers from each of the four core ethnicities were invited to speak. Mr Chen Dinghui, curator of the Sun Yat Sen Nanyang Memorial Hall was the Chinese speaker; Indian Women’s Association Singapore President Ms Sukanya Pushkarna was the Indian speaker; Chinese scholar Mr Jaffar Kassim was the Malay speaker and local writer Ms Denyse Tessensohn was the Eurasian speaker. Participants were able to understand how ancestors of each ethnic group overcame difficulties to build their homes.
